Fortunafi Fortunafi
Fortunafi is an on-chain financial institution that delivers solutions for stablecoin issuers, protocol treasuries, and traditional entities. Our offerings include a variety of investment products, such as private and public debt funds. $9.5M / Seed / May 29, 2024
Codat Codat
Codat is a London-based technology company that lets banks and fintech plug into their small businesses and the software they use, giving them seamless access to real-time customer data. Codat is building an ecosystem of connected datasets that handle the heavy lifting of integrations, leaving providers free to focus on improving their offeringsfor small businesses.Codat has over 60 clients globally, across various different industries from traditional lenders to invoice financing, insurance to cashflow forecasting. $100M / Series C / Jun 08, 2022
Simetrik Simetrik
Simetrik is a no-code solution that offers the right balance between flexibility and robustness for the reconciliation process automation. The company's approach allows us to offer a unique solution that provides efficiency and productivity, empowering finance and operations teams, in both tech and traditional companies, to customize andmaintain end-to-end automations for a great diversity of use cases and geographies. On the other hand, our secure big data infrastructure guarantees control of operational, compliance, and reputational risks, supporting high volumes of data, which, combined with a world-class team, allows customers to implement and trust Simetrik at scale. The company is reconciling $75 Bn of TPV per year in over 28 countries and serving well-known names across the industry, including Mercado Pago, Rappi Bank, NuBank, Bancolombia, Addi, DLocal, Clara, Clip, and Banco Falabella. $20M / Series A / Mar 24, 2022
Monite Monite
Monite is an AI-powered Embedded AR/AP provider – it lets SMB platforms (vSaaS, payment providers, fintechs) embed AR/invoicing, AP automation/bill pay & cashflow management into their interface in 3-5 weeks. We power dozens of platforms across US, EU, and other regions. We are backed by Valar Ventures, ThirdPrime, P72,s16,Audeo, founders of Klarna & Nium, and executives from Plaid, PayPal & Square. $5.1M / Seed / Feb 22, 2022
Ocrolus Ocrolus
Ocrolus is a document automation platform that powers the digital lending ecosystem, automating credit decisions across fintech, mortgage, and banking. The company provides document analysis infrastructure to customers like PayPal, Brex, SoFi, and Plaid, and has raised over $100 million from blue-chip fintech investors. Ocrolus enables financialservices firms to make high quality decisions with trusted data and unparalleled efficiency. $13.5M / Series B / Aug 25, 2020

About Plaid

VC Fund · San Francisco, United States

Plaid is the technology platform providing the tools and access needed for the development of a fully modern, and digitally-enabled financial system. Plaid makes it easier and safer for developers — from the smallest startups to the largest financial institutions — to build innovative financial services and applications. Plaid offers beautifulconsumer experiences, developer-friendly infrastructure, and intelligence tools that give everyone the ability to build the future of financial services.Plaid was launched by William Hockey and Zach Perret in 2012 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
